Introducer(s): Sen. Donald E. Williams, 29th Dist. Sen. Martin M. Looney, 11th Dist. Rep. Christopher G. Donovan, 84th Dist. Rep. Brendan Sharkey, 88th Dist.

Title: AN ACT ENHANCING EMERGENCY PREPAREDNESS AND RESPONSE.

Statement of Purpose: To implement the Governor's budget recommendations.

Bill History:

02/09/12 REFERRED TO JOINT COMMITTEE ON Energy and Technology Committee 03/16/12 PUBLIC HEARING 03/20 03/28/12 JOINT FAVORABLE SUBSTITUTE 03/28/12 FILED WITH LEGISLATIVE COMMISSIONERS' OFFICE 04/05/12 REFERRED TO OFFICE OF LEGISLATIVE RESEARCH AND OFFICE OF FISCAL ANALYSIS 04/11/12-5:00 PM 04/12/12 REPORTED OUT OF LEGISLATIVE COMMISSIONERS' OFFICE 04/12/12 FAVORABLE REPORT, TABLED FOR THE CALENDAR, SENATE 04/12/12 SENATE CALENDAR NUMBER 289 04/12/12 FILE NUMBER 401 05/05/12 SENATE ADOPTED SENATE AMENDMENT SCHEDULE A:LCO-5079 05/05/12 SENATE PASSED AS AMENDED BY SENATE AMENDMENT SCHEDULE A 05/05/12 TRANSMITTED PURSUANT TO THE JOINT RULES 05/06/12 FAVORABLE REPORT, TABLED FOR THE CALENDAR, HOUSE 05/06/12 HOUSE CALENDAR NUMBER 518 05/09/12 HOUSE ADOPTED SENATE AMENDMENT SCHEDULE A 05/09/12 HOUSE PASSED AS AMENDED BY SENATE AMENDMENT SCHEDULE A 05/09/12 IN CONCURRENCE 05/29/12 PUBLIC ACT 12-148 05/31/12 TRANSMITTED TO THE SECRETARY OF STATE 06/15/12 SIGNED BY THE GOVERNOR
